Basketball Men's B-League starts October 2nd, 13th July 17:12

The B. League of basketball men announced that it will be October 2 this year after taking measures against the infection of the new coronavirus on the opening day of this season.

The B League held a conference in Tokyo on the 13th and announced the outline of the next season.

The opening day will be October 2nd, and the match between Arbulk Tokyo, which has won the league title for the second time in the first part of B1, and Kawasaki Brave Sanders, who won the last season's middle district, will be held on this day ahead of other matches. became.

In addition, as a measure against new coronavirus infection, perform PCR inspections every two weeks for athletes and team staff during the season, and create guidelines for infection measures that refer to the J League of professional baseball and soccer. Revealed.

In addition, regarding the final of the championship that decides the winning team of the season, this season's method will be changed from the method of finalizing one game so far to winning the first two games.

Daiki Tanaka from Tokyo and Yuma Fujii from Kawasaki also attended the conference, and Tanaka, who won the MVP = Best Player Award last season, said, "I'm looking forward to playing in front of the fans. , I want to prepare for the opening race while working on safety measures."
